Q » Is it worth hiring professional engineering in Bristol for residential needs?

A » Engaging a professional engineer in Bristol for residential projects is advisable to ensure structural integrity and compliance with local regulations. Their expertise mitigates risks, optimizes designs, and enhances property value. Given Bristol's diverse housing and geology, local knowledge reduces unforeseen costs, protecting your investment.

A »Engaging professional engineering services in Bristol for residential projects is strongly advisable. Licensed engineers ensure structural integrity, regulatory compliance, and optimized designs, which can prevent costly errors and enhance property value. For complex renovations, extensions, or safety-critical work, their expertise offers essential risk mitigation and long-term reliability. While an upfront investment, this professional oversight typically justifies itself through quality assurance and peace of mind.
